Several of the SUMO devs have a general feeling of hmm-this-is-confusing when going through the AAQ workflow, but we don't want to change the design without input from the product folks. I'm opening this bug to keep track of some of the specifics so we can bring them up at some point after the 2.2 launch, bang them against user feedback, and decide what to do. So, specifically...
* Progress indication. There isn't a[n Amazon-checkout-style] progress indicator, so you have no idea how lengthy a process you've gotten yourself into.
* Wording. For example, I was on the Ask a New Question page and clicked Provide More Details. I was surprised to land at another page that says "Ask a New Question". Didn't I just ask my question? I don't want to ask another new one.
* Disorienting scrolling. For example, after I first type my question and click Ask This, my question goes flying to some other part of the window, given a short enough viewport, because we redirect to a named anchor. We do this to help ensure the search suggestions are visible, but it is disorienting. An AJAX alternative might improve the experience for the bulk of users.

We have solved 1, 2 and 3, but it is still not where we'd like to have it. There will be a bigger rework, once we can figure out where we are standing with regards to click through rates. I'm closing this bug since the specifically mentioned issues were fixed.
